This specific type of ammunition consists of small lead or steel pellets loaded into a .22 caliber cartridge. Typically used in small-bore rifles and pistols, it is designed to disperse upon firing, creating a pattern effective against small game and pests at close range. An example would be its use for controlling rodents or dispatching birds in confined spaces.

The relatively low power of this ammunition makes it suitable for situations where over-penetration is a concern. Its effectiveness at short distances, combined with reduced noise and recoil compared to larger calibers, contributes to its popularity. Historically, this type of ammunition played a role in pest control on farms and homesteads, and continues to be a relevant choice for similar applications today.

1. Caliber

The “.22” in “.22 caliber birdshot ammunition” denotes the bore diameter of the firearm barrel for which the ammunition is designed. This measurement, approximately 0.22 inches, is a critical factor influencing the ammunition’s performance characteristics. The .22 caliber is a common choice for this type of ammunition due to the balance it strikes between projectile velocity, manageable recoil, and cost-effectiveness. This caliber allows for effective pest control at close range without excessive noise or recoil, making it suitable for use in various environments, including residential areas. Using a .22 caliber firearm with incorrectly sized ammunition could lead to dangerous malfunctions or reduced accuracy.

The .22 caliber designation encompasses a range of specific cartridge types, including .22 Long Rifle, .22 Short, and .22 Winchester Magnum Rimfire. Understanding the specific cartridge designation is crucial for safe and effective firearm operation. While .22 Long Rifle is the most prevalent type used with birdshot, other .22 caliber cartridges may also be employed, each offering different performance characteristics regarding velocity and energy. For instance, .22 Short cartridges, while less powerful, may be preferable for extremely close-range pest control in confined spaces due to reduced report and recoil.

Appropriate caliber selection is paramount for safety and efficacy. Using ammunition of the incorrect caliber can result in firearm damage, malfunction, or personal injury. 2. Shot type

Birdshot, as a component of .22 caliber ammunition, defines its functionality and suitability for specific applications. Unlike single projectiles, birdshot consists of numerous small pellets contained within the cartridge. Upon firing, these pellets disperse in a cone-shaped pattern, increasing the probability of striking small, fast-moving targets at close range. This characteristic makes .22 birdshot effective for pest control, particularly against small birds and rodents. The shot size, typically #12 or smaller, ensures sufficient pellet density for target neutralization while minimizing the risk of over-penetration. For example, controlling starlings in an aviary or eliminating mice in a storage shed are appropriate applications of this ammunition type. Using a single projectile in such scenarios would likely prove less effective due to the target’s agility and the limited margin for error in aiming.

The effectiveness of birdshot hinges upon the interplay between pellet size, shot pattern, and target distance. Smaller shot sizes contain more pellets, resulting in denser patterns, but with reduced individual pellet energy. Conversely, larger shot sizes, though fewer in number, possess greater individual pellet energy but create wider, less dense patterns. The optimal balance depends on the specific target and engagement distance. For instance, while #12 shot might suffice for sparrows at close range, larger shot, such as #9, might prove more effective against rats or larger birds at slightly extended distances. Understanding this interplay is crucial for selecting the appropriate ammunition for the intended purpose and ensuring humane dispatch.

3. Purpose

The primary purpose of .22 caliber birdshot ammunition is pest control. This stems from the ammunition’s inherent characteristics: the small caliber limits power and range, mitigating risks associated with over-penetration; the birdshot’s multiple projectiles increase hit probability against small, agile targets; and the lower report compared to larger calibers often makes it more suitable for use in populated areas. This combination of factors positions .22 birdshot as a practical solution for managing pest populations, particularly in environments where safety and precision are paramount. For instance, a farmer might utilize this ammunition to control rodents within barns or storage facilities, minimizing the risk of damage to property or livestock. Similarly, homeowners may find it effective for managing bird populations around fruit trees or gardens, reducing crop damage while minimizing disturbance to neighbors.

The effectiveness of .22 birdshot for pest control relies on responsible application. Appropriate target selection is crucial, as the limited energy of birdshot necessitates close-range shots to ensure humane dispatch. Furthermore, environmental considerations must inform ammunition choice. Lead birdshot, while effective, can pose environmental risks; therefore, steel or other non-toxic alternatives might be preferred in sensitive areas. Understanding the ammunition’s limitations, including effective range and target suitability, contributes to its ethical and responsible use. Shooting at inappropriate targets, such as protected species, or using excessive force can lead to legal repercussions and ecological damage. Effective pest control requires integrating ammunition choice with broader integrated pest management strategies, including habitat modification and exclusion methods.

Effective Use and Safety Guidelines

The following guidelines offer practical advice for maximizing the effectiveness and safety of this specific ammunition type.

Tip 1: Target Selection: Appropriate target selection is paramount. Limit use to small pests at close range. This ammunition is generally suitable for small birds or rodents, not larger animals. Misapplication can lead to unnecessary suffering and ethical concerns.

Tip 2: Range Estimation: Effective range is limited. Practice accurate range estimation to ensure hits within the ammunition’s optimal performance envelope. Beyond a certain distance, shot spread reduces effectiveness, potentially causing injury without a humane kill.

Tip 3: Shot Placement: Precise shot placement is essential for humane dispatch. Aim for vital areas to minimize suffering. Random shots are unethical and may violate local hunting or pest control regulations.

Tip 4: Environmental Awareness: Consider the environmental impact of ammunition choice. Lead shot can pose environmental risks. Opt for steel or non-toxic alternatives, especially near water sources or sensitive habitats.

Tip 5: Safety Gear: Always wear appropriate safety gear, including eye and ear protection. This ammunition, while less powerful than larger calibers, still poses potential risks to hearing and eyesight.

Tip 6: Legal Compliance: Adhere to all local regulations regarding firearm ownership, ammunition use, and pest control practices. Laws vary by jurisdiction; ignorance is not a defense.

Tip 7: Secure Storage: Store ammunition securely, away from children and unauthorized individuals. Proper storage prevents accidents and ensures the ammunition remains in optimal condition.

Tip 8: Responsible Disposal: Dispose of spent cartridges responsibly. Littering poses environmental risks. Recycle spent cartridges where possible or dispose of them in designated hazardous waste receptacles.
